Brand History and Reputation

Estée Lauder started in a New York kitchen in the 1940s, when a young woman named Estée turned homemade creams into a global empire. The company grew by focusing on high‑quality ingredients and a personal touch – think trial‑size gifts and one‑on‑one consultations. One of the biggest draws is the Advanced Night Repair serum. It’s praised for smoothing fine lines and boosting radiance, and it often appears in best‑seller lists. Another star is the Double Wear Foundation, known for 24‑hour wear without caking. Both products illustrate the brand’s promise: high performance that feels luxurious.

Estée Lauder also invests in sustainability. Recent packaging upgrades use recyclable materials, and the company funds research on eco‑friendly ingredients. This effort appeals to shoppers who care about the planet as much as their skin.

When it comes to price, you’ll find a range. There are entry‑level products like the Essentials line, and high‑end items like the Re‑Nutriv collection. This tiered approach means most people can find something that fits their budget while still getting a taste of luxury.

Does Estee Lauder Test on Animals?

Estee Lauder's animal testing policy is a hot topic among beauty enthusiasts. While they committed to reducing animal testing, challenges in certain markets, like China, exist. Consumers increasingly seek alternatives that align with cruelty-free values, emphasizing the need for transparency from brands.
